Everyone was waiting for Lady Gaga's appearance on the Golden Globes 2019 red carpet, and boy did she deliver.

The performer, who is nominated for Best Actress in a Motion Picture - Drama for her role in musical remake A Star Is Born, declared millennial pink all but dead in a lavender-blue couture Valentino gown, complemented by an equally giant Tiffany necklace.

Never one to under-do it, the 32-year-old dyed her intricately structured hair a matching hue, proving colour drenching is going absolutely nowhere.

Fans have been Tweeting pictures and videos of the 'Pokerface' star as she arrived looking like a regal mermaid at the awards show.

Of course, there's always more to a Gaga outfit, and it turns out social media sleuths have unearthed an image of Judy Garland in a similar outfit in 1954.

Gaga obviously played the same role as Garland in A Star Is Born - a role also shared with musical icon Barbra Streisand.

Speaking of the hard work she put in, in order to perform the role, and how director and co-star Bradley Cooper pushed her, the fashion frontrunner told Ryan Seacrest:

He said something to me and I just said my same line again and again, and he said 'are you ok?' and I said 'I don't think so' and he said 'do you need to cry?' and I just said 'I think so' and then this scene happened as written but it happened in a much more organic way.
He taught me how to be present on set. And that was really invaluable.
